Cassava Technologies to Invest $720M in Africa’s First AI Factory

Cassava Technologies, founded by Zimbabwean billionaire Strive Masiyiwa, will invest up to $720 million in Africa’s first AI factory, developed in partnership with Nvidia. The ambitious plan starts with deploying 3,000 Nvidia GPUs in South Africa by June, with expansions to Nigeria, Egypt, Kenya, and Morocco. Over the next few years, the company aims to roll out 12,000 GPUs continent-wide, building a robust AI ecosystem. The facility will support research, start-ups, and industries like healthcare and fintech. Cassava also plans to sell excess computing power to global Nvidia clients. The initiative is a bold move to ensure Africa isn’t left behind in the fourth industrial revolution.
